Maison  >  Article  >  interface Web  >  Bibliothèque de chargement paresseux d'images JavaScript Astuces Echo.js_javascript

Bibliothèque de chargement paresseux d'images JavaScript Astuces Echo.js_javascript

WBOY
WBOYoriginal
2016-05-16 15:06:351873parcourir

Echo est un outil indépendant de chargement d'images paresseux JavaScript, rapide, de petite taille (moins de 1 Ko) et utilisant l'attribut data-HTML5. Echo prend en charge IE8+.

Description du plug-in : comme Lazy Load, Echo.js est également un JavaScript pour le chargement paresseux des images. La différence est que Lazy Load est un plug-in basé sur jQuery, tandis qu'Echo.js ne dépend pas de jQuery ou d'autres bibliothèques JavaScript et peut être utilisé indépendamment. Et Echo.js est très petit, moins de 1 Ko après compression.

Compatibilité

Echo.js utilise l'attribut date de HTML5 et doit obtenir la valeur de cet attribut, il n'est donc pas compatible avec IE6 et IE7. Bien que Lazy Load utilise également l'attribut de date HTML5, sa méthode d'obtention de la valeur est différente.

Comment utiliser

 1. Importer des fichiers

Copier le code Le code est le suivant :

e186917f42360ce89b568cf30c2894c52cacc6d41bbb37262a98f745aa00fbf0
 

2.HTML

Copier le code Le code est le suivant :
3b07d364e6c3d8e47cb51f97b541aee4

blank.gif est une image 1 x 1, utilisée comme image par défaut, et la valeur de l'attribut data-echo est la véritable adresse de l'image. Il est également préférable de définir la largeur et la hauteur de l'image, ou de la définir en CSS, sinon l'image qui semble tout en bas sera retardée lors du chargement.

 

3.JavaScript


Echo.init({
offset: 0,
throttle: 0
}); 
Paramètres


Paramètres

Description

offset

参数

说明

offset 离可视区域多少像素的图片可以被加载
throttle 图片延迟多少毫秒加载
À combien de pixels de la zone visible une image peut-elle être chargée
accélérateur

De combien de millisecondes le chargement de l'image est-il retardé
Le contenu ci-dessus est destiné à la bibliothèque de chargement paresseux d'images JavaScript Echo.js. J'espère qu'il sera utile à tout le monde !
Déclaration:
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n